DH4 4BA is an up-and-coming urban area located 0.5km from Grasswell in Houghton-le-Spring. Administratively it sits within Copt Hill ward and the Houghton and Sunderland South constituency.
This is a strong family neighbourhood — a family-oriented neighbourhood with a mix of housing types. Work and footfall patterns mark this as a non-metropolitan suburban areas zone — white, female workforce with low qualifications, working locally. This is a stable, socially diverse area (average age 44) — accessible for a wide range of households, from young families to empty nesters. 68% of properties are owner-occupied — a strong indicator of neighbourhood stability and long-term community investment.
Safety: Crime rates are above average at 112 incidents per 1,000 residents — worth reviewing the crime breakdown below.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.
Census 2021 statistics for DH4 4BA are sourced from Output Area E00044251 (shared with 8 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.

gavel Crime Overview 12 Months (up to 2026-01)
Crime around DH4 4BA is above average at 112 per 1,000 residents. The most reported categories are shoplifting and violence and sexual offences. Commercial streets and transport hubs naturally generate more incidents than quiet residential roads.
